{title:Gaps between dot lines}
{p2colset 4 32 35 0}
{p 3 3 2}
These entries specify the size of gaps between dot lines. Dot lines occupy an area
similar to the area of a bar in a bar graph. All values for {it:#}s are percentages
of the width of that dot area.
{p2col:entry} description{p_end}
{p2line}
{p2col:{cmd:relsize dot_gap} {space 8}{it:#}}
distance between dot lines not in an {cmd:over()} group{p_end}
{p2col:{cmd:relsize dot_groupgap} {space 3}{it:#}}
distance between dot lines in the first {cmd:over()} group{p_end}
{p2col:{cmd:relsize dot_supgroupgap} {space 0}{it:#}}
distance between dot lines in the second {cmd:over()} group{p_end}
{p2col:{cmd:relsize dot_outergap} {space 3}{it:#}}
distance between the outermost dot lines and the left and right
boundaries of the plot region{p_end}
{p2line}
{title:Appearance of dot lines}
{p2colset 4 47 50 0}
{p 3 3 2}
These entries specify the type and look of ruler lines, or dot lines, drawn
for each category on a dot graph.
{p 3 3 2}
The type of "ruler", or dot line, drawn is determined by the
{cmd:dottypestyle dot} entry, where its {it:dotstyle} may be {cmd:dot},
{cmd:line}, or {cmd:rectangle}. If this setting is {cmd:dot}, the
grouping of entries specifying marker characteristics is used; if it is
{cmd:line}, the grouping specifying line characteristics is used; and, if
it is {cmd:rectangle}, the area and line entries for a rectangle are used.
